Endpoint Licenses
New Endpoint licenses are now available in FortiOS 5.2. Information about the status of the current license can be found in the FortiClient section of the License Information widget.
The following licenses will be available:
Desktop models and FortiGate-VM00: 200 clients
1U models, FortiGate-VM01 and FortiGate-VM02: 2,000 clients
2U models and FortiGate-VM04: 8,000 clients
3U models, FortiGate-ATCA, and FortiGate-VM08: 20,000 clients
Because the new licenses are for one year, the activation method has changed. New licenses are purchased similarly to a FortiGuard service, with no further registration of the license required. The device can then be registered with the FortiGate unit.
If the device does not have access to Internet, you can download the license key from support site and manually upload it to your FortiGate. The license will be for that specific device and will have an license expiry date.
While the older licenses from FortiOS 5.0 will still be supported, they will have the following limitations:
The On-Net Status feature will not be supported.
Logging options will only appear in the CLI.
FortiAnalyzer Support for logging and reporting will be limited.
You will not be able to enter any v5.0 license keys.
